Tour Rules
Sandals, flip flops, heels, and any kind of open-toed shoes ARE NOT PERMITTED for safety reasons
. You will be denied boarding if you do not have proper footwear. Wear rubber-soled sneakers or walking shoes. Also, shorts or pants are suggested for women. Avoid jewelry or straps that might get caught on a ladder or ship's equipment.

Infants and toddlers are not allowed, due to safety concerns, and child care is not available in the terminal. Children should be around 5 years old and able to climb stairwells and ladders without assistance. Strollers are not allowed, and children cannot be carried or ride in a carrier.

All visitors must PRINT OUT their tickets, and adults over the age of 18 must bring a government-issued ID. Foreign nationals must bring a passport. All guests are subject to additional security screening inside the terminal.
